Meet the greater bilby (Macrotis lagotis)! As a nocturnal marsupial from Australia, it spends most of its day hanging out in deep burrows, which can be as far as 10 feet (3 meters) below the surface. It’s an expert digger equipped with strong, clawed forelimbs. The female’s pouch faces backwards—preventing soil from entering the pouch while the mother digs! Its enormous ears help this insect-hunter hear termites and other prey underground.
